Yeah, because what happens with the trap bar deadlift, guys, is the weight is more evenly distributed.
00:04:45.000
So, it doesn't put as much strain on your lower back as like, you know, a traditional barbell deadlift.
00:04:53.000
Another way to get around it, guys, you could do a sumo deadlift.
00:04:55.000
That also takes a bit less off the lower back, places it more on your legs.
00:05:00.000
So, those are some ways I get around it if I really want to deadlift.

And for those that are listening, Drug Enforcement Administration, DEA, is a part of the Department of Justice.
00:40:07.000
Then you've got Homeland Security Investigations, HSI, who I used to work for.
00:40:11.000
Both agencies actually have Title 21, which is the authority to investigate drug trafficking offenses.
00:40:19.000
However, HSI does a lot of drug cases too because a lot of drugs come in internationally.
00:40:23.000
When it comes internationally, boom, HSI is going to go ahead and have jurisdiction on that.
00:40:27.000
And you can always say cocaine, you know, a lot of these drugs, the strong methamphetamine that comes from Mexico, it's not U.S. based.
00:40:36.000
So there's always a jurisdiction and like a nexus to the border when it comes to Title 21 most of the time.

We're sold in If in a calorie deficit for too long, metabolism adjusts, making it harder to lose weight.
02:49:38.000
That is true because as you lose weight, your body will adapt.
02:49:41.000
And remember, You're losing weight, which means you're becoming a smaller version of yourself.
02:49:45.000
If you become a smaller version of yourself, you don't need as many calories to maintain.
02:49:51.000
So your caloric needs to go down alongside you losing weight.
02:49:56.000
So the way to get around that, which is called a plateau, just slowly and systematically decrease 100 calories every time you hit a sticking point.
02:50:04.000
So let's say you eat 2000 calories, you lose 5 pounds off of that, right?
02:50:11.000
Well, if you stop losing weight and you're stuck at 195 for like two weeks eating 2000 calories, drop it down to 1900 and the weight loss will continue again.
02:50:24.000
But the only way you can do that, guys, is you have to track your calories.
02:50:27.000
If you're not tracking your calories and you're trying to lose weight, it's a waste of fucking time.
02:50:32.000
Because you need to be in a calorie deficit to lose weight.
02:50:35.000
If you're not trying your calories, you're basically operating blind.
02:50:37.000
It's like trying to drive somewhere you've never been before without a GPS. Absolutely ridiculous.
